Key Discussion Points & Topics Covered:

  • Economic Foundations: Discussion on municipal self-sufficiency, caste-regulated wealth distribution, and how trade is structured as a mechanism for state survival under local statutes and Gorean law.

  • Three Operational Realities:

    1. Concrete Currency Standard: The rejection of abstract credit/fiat concepts in favor of physical coin transactions (Gold Tarsk, Silver Tarsk, copper bits).

    2. Caste Monopoly System: Strict adherence to guild/caste charters and trade licenses to prevent individual economic overreach.

    3. Strategic Reserve Tax: Municipal tariffs collected on incoming goods (grain, iron, textiles) to supply central granaries and public arsenals against sieges or shortages.

  • Clarifications & Book References:

    • Carola clarified the local administrative distinction regarding registering Castes/sub-castes and filing business licenses directly with the city.

    • Petra provided a textual reference (Smugglers of Gor, Book 32, Page 522) regarding Gold Tarsks in response to Anja's query.

  • Practical Scenario: Evaluated a scenario involving a foreign trader attempting to circulate paper "Certificates of Cargo Value." Established that under local laws, unbacked paper credit is treated as economic subversion resulting in cargo confiscation, vessel forfeiture, and public destruction of the paper tokens.

Meeting 4: Merchant Law vs. Civil Law Lecture

  • Host/Speaker: Ambassador Kaellaed Rhode

  • Location: Merchant Academy Podium / Turmus

  • Key Topics & Discussions:

    • Civil Law vs. Merchant Law:

      • Civil Law: Localized "within the Home Stone walls," governing property, companionship, and criminal offenses under traditional Gorean societal norms.

      • Merchant Law: Universal across Gor (maintained at Sardar Fairs), governing trade standards, coinage values (gold tarn disc), weight/measurement standardization, and regional trade monopolies (e.g., black wine).

    • Inter-Caste Cooperation: Highlighted that commerce relies on the collaboration of Merchants (trade/quality), Scribes (legal contracts/records), Physicians (injury/health standards), and Warriors (enforcement).

    • Enforcement Debate: ThunderBolt Kanto raised points regarding the historical judicial authority of Merchant Magistrates over market fraud, leading to a friendly discussion on how civil warriors/magistrates and merchant authorities overlap in city governance.

Lecture Notes: The Rights and Framework of Slave Discipline

  • Event Type: Educational Hall Lecture & Discussion

  • Location: Educational Hall (Building #25), Turmus

  • Instructor: Lady Kati Evans

  • Attendees: Ubara Selia (violet325), Advocate Aries Marchese (d3athmak3r3), Slaver Nicholas Eel, ThunderBolt Kanto, Lady Carola, Lady Iona, Trygg Tyran, Cheryl (cherylsue.snoodle), Amalia (amaliajimenez), Jean (jean1), Darla/Aurora (darlagraysun), Lora (hannalora), Mel (melanie.fiddlesticks), Uli Roff, and others.

Key Presentation & Discussion Points:

  • Purpose of Discipline:

    • Discipline maintains civic order and proper protocol; a slave's behavior reflects on the entire city and their owner's honor.

    • Correction is non-malicious and intended to restore alertness and deference.

  • Public Stock vs. Private Property:

    • Public Stock: Any free citizen has the right to correct public city slaves immediately on the spot for protocol breaches.

    • Private Property: Free citizens may issue commands and deliver minor, non-damaging physical reminders (such as a reprimand or quick slap) to private slaves who fail to yield or show proper honorifics.

    • Property Restitution: Free citizens must never permanently injure, brand, or destroy another citizen's private property. Severe infractions must be handled by the owner or brought to the Magistrate's Court.

  • Hair Shearing Laws:

    • It is strictly illegal under Gorean commercial law to cut a slave's hair without the owner's explicit permission, as hair represents substantial commercial asset value. Unauthorized shearing constitutes property destruction requiring full financial restitution.

  • Graduated Correction Levels:

    • Minor: Verbal reprimand, slap, repeating protocol for missed greetings or posture slips.

    • Moderate: Temporary placement in public stocks or binding at the city gates for public disturbances or slacking on errands.

    • Severe: Scourging, branding, or referral to hard labor (e.g., Salt Mines of Klima) for runaways, theft, or treason.
